    Pretty much every successful club at any level has something in common re. recruitment - they have an identifiable footballing style, and strategy for the club, and a selection process whereby there'll be an ultimate decision maker - but more than one individual has a say. Leaving it solely to the discretion of the manager is out-dated and results in the continual cycle of rebuilding we subject ourselves to.
